Nars Laguna 
Laguna is another very popular bronzer. It is a bronze powder with a golden shimmer, so it gives your skin a really healthy looking glow. I love using this bronzer in the summer as it is warm toned and makes my face look even more tanned. I like that the shimmer is subtle and not too sparkly. I prefer to use Laguna on the points of my face that the sun would naturally hit, so my forehead, nose, etc. Laguna works best for me to give skin a tanned glow rather than using it as a contour powder.

Anastasia Beverly Hills Cream Contour Kit
This product is one of my everyday, go to products. I love how buildable the creams are. For an everyday look I only apply a small amount and blend it well, where as on a night I build it up and make my contour look a lot sharper and cut. They are so easy to blend and work with. I find it applies best with my finger and then I blend it with a beauty blender.

Anastasia Beverly Hills Powder Contour Kit
Another go to product, as you can tell by the photo it is very well used! I apply these contour colours over my cream contour to set it and also make it look more defined. I also sometimes use this on its own if I am in a hurry and don't have time to use the cream contour. It also has a really nice shimmery highlight shade! I love the banana highlighter in this kit, I use it to set my concealer under my eyes and the places I have used the banana cream highlight. I really need to restock on this one!

Anastasia Beverly Hills Glow Kit - Gleam
This is probably my favourite make up product I have bought this year. I cannot praise it enough! The highlighters are so so pigmented, definitely the most pigmented highlighter I own. You only need a tiny amount on your brush when applying, meaning that the product will last a while. They are also very long wearing, at the end of the day they are still really shimmery. Every time I get a compliment on my highlight that I'm wearing, it is this one. I love using the golden shade Mimosa when I have a tan, I can tell this one will be used the most throughout summer! All the shades work with different make up looks. I just love this product so much, can you tell?

Nars Duel Intensity - Craving
This is such a handy product, as you have a cheek highlighting shade and a bronze highlighting shade. The pigmentation is very good and they also last all day on my face. When using this product I spray some MAC Fix Plus on my brush first and the product goes on seamlessly. I like wearing this highlighter on its own when I'm having a day where I wear hardly any make up and probably only do my eyebrows and apply some lipstick. It makes your skin glow and the bronze shade enhances a tan really well if applied lightly to the forehead and hollows of your cheeks, and the places where the sun would naturally hit.

Guerlain - Perles D'or
This is such a gorgeous product. It is a pot of illuminating powder pearls that you swirl your brush in and apply. There is a mixture of white, gold, pink and lilac pearls that all blend together when applied. I was originally drawn in by the packaging of this product when I bought it as it is really pretty and I like that it is metal so it does not get damaged as easily as the cardboard palettes. The product itself is not very pigmented and is not my favourite and I do regret buying it as it is quite pricey. But, it is lovely for if you want just a light dusting of shimmer on your cheeks.
